Curriculum

Young learners need the support and structure of an accredited curriculum and teaching staff to reach their learning goals. One pedagogy that has gained acclaim in recent years in the Early Years Foundation Stage (EYFS) program out of England.

EYFS focuses on a play-based learning system where students engage with teachers and are encouraged to lead learning activities and exercises. Teachers work closely with students to identify the best learning techniques that work with each student and then tailor lessons and activities to fit their style and address and problem areas.

Staff

Because kindergarden is such a critical and formative time of a student’s educational journey, the teaching staff on hand to support them learn and grow are highly important. Each teacher should have the proper certification and training to deal with young learners and demonstrate the ability to work with students and help them maximize their potential.

Proper schools will allow you and your child to meet with the staff to see if your child is comfortable learning from them. After all, the student-teacher relationship fostered at school can chart the course for a student’s lifelong learning journey.
